SMBC Aviation Capital closes GAEL II fund

SMBC Aviation Capital has closed GAEL II (Global Aviation Equipment Leasing), its second fund targeting the Japanese financial investor market. 

GAEL II is a closed-end fund which has raised equity capital from 14 Japanese investors to acquire a portfolio of eight aircraft from SMBC Aviation Capital. The lessor launched GAEL I in 2019. 

“GAEL II is an opportunity for a number of Japanese equity investors to deploy capital into stable and predictable returns backed by a high-quality portfolio of aircraft that will be serviced by SMBC Aviation Capital,” said SMBC Aviation Capital head of aircraft trading Michael Littleton. 

In addition to its joint venture with La Caisse, which launched in 2024, as well as its growing Japanese operating lease business, the lessor manages 110 aircraft valued at over $4.5bn on behalf of its investor customers.
